About Hardware NVIDIA GeForce MX350

NVIDIA GeForce MX350 is a mobile GPU based on Pascal architecture, with 640 CUDA cores and 2GB GDDR5 VRAM.

This GPU is designed as an upgrade solution from Intel UHD/Iris Xe Graphics, offering better power efficiency for medium graphics tasks. With support for DirectX 12 and OpenGL 4.6, the MX350 is suitable for everyday computing, light editing, and multimedia needs.

About Hardware ARM Mali-450 MP

ARM Mali-450 MP is a low-power GPU used in a variety of mobile chipsets and embedded devices, including set-top boxes and Android TVs. It supports OpenGL ES 2.0 and has up to 8 shader cores, depending on the configuration.

Compared to its predecessor, Mali-400, Mali-450 offers improvements in graphics processing efficiency and memory bandwidth. However, due to its fairly old architecture, this GPU is more suitable for simple UI display, video playback, and light gaming on low-end devices.
